RALEIGH, N.C., April 19 (UPI) -- Travis Zajac's overtime goal Sunday gave the New Jersey Devils a 3-2 win over Carolina and a 2-1 lead in their Eastern Conference quarterfinal series.

Zajac was assisted by Zach Parise and Colin White on the game-winner just under 5 minutes into the extra session.

Parise and Brian Gionta scored the other Devils' goals.

Ryan Bayda and Chad LaRose posted the Hurricanes' scores.

New Jersey goalie Martin Brodeur totaled 28 saves and Cam Ward had 35 for Carolina.

Game 4 will be in Raleigh, N.C., Tuesday.
